I just finished the dac and hook up to the CDP at the moment because I don't have a USB to SPDIF converter yet. The pads for the Q2 were tight and the WM8804 needed to be patience, dial in the correct soldering temperature and good quality of wick to remove excessive solder on the WM8804. Hi Sidney, beautiful build ! An example for a good layout with 230 V AC far away from SPDIF and L+ R outputs. IMO you build can inspire many builders for a successful placement of boards and connections. One tiny point is that the power LED has little function where it is now ;) How does it sound ?

I take many like to have all connections at the backside of the case. In that case please route the 230 V AC wiring far away from the main DAC board and keep AC wiring short.

I see our choice for changing the MKDSN for Molex KK connectors has resulted in people soldering input and output wiring straight to the board. Pity as they are good connectors but one needs to have the crimping tool. It would have been a success if we had delivered cable harnesses with the board I guess. Again something that is learnt in the process...

It didn't work the first time, so I was worried for Q2 :( After, I checked the voltage on ES9023 and WM8804 (thanks atapi!) and everything matched within 5%
Finally, it was a dry joint on wm8804 pin 2 (the sw mode pin, if I'm not wrong)! After that, it started to play :)

Hello, I would check:

- U3 & U4 pins continuity (with no PS): from the photos... it seems that a short could be there.
- RN1, third resistor from top: it seems that the right pin is not well soldered.
- of course, I do not think that an occasional short on the input spdif made a problem to the DAC. It was just the event that triggered a already present problem...
